Transaction 29580ba970f6e9af9be2379a1d9777427e858cf9cf317959ce1f1046ffa3bb16
2 Input
2 Outputs
- 29580ba970f6e9af9be2379a1d9777427e858cf9cf317959ce1f1046ffa3bb16:0
- 29580ba970f6e9af9be2379a1d9777427e858cf9cf317959ce1f1046ffa3bb16:1
value 4200506
address 1Lb2n7MRX93LsEe6PtvqHnr7JzrkVi1cDL
value 955206
address 1Dd4pDEy5pqp1KE8fTpd2MRTtaxKkmiFEX